The Single-Molecule Dynamics in Cells group takes an interdisciplinary approach to solve fundamental questions about how living systems adapt to extreme environments, employing a range of techniques from biophysics, molecular biology, genetics, to computational biology. The research will also contribute to the development of robust synthetic biology applications and novel assay solutions.

Keywords: Biophysics, Single-molecule imaging, Machine learning, Cell biology, Microbiology, Temperature adaptation, Extremophiles.
